On Sun, 11 Jan 2004 22:49:08 -0700 David Stevens <dlstevens@xxxxxxxxxx> wrote: > Although IGMPv3 didn't have any problems, this patch > also re-arranges the order of the filter changes. I think it's cleaner > to add the new one first and then delete the old one, rather than > having a small window with no filter set. So, this is a bug fix for MLD > and a code clean-up for IGMPv3. > This bug and patch should also apply to the 2.4 line. Applied, thank you David.
